Yeah the hardest difficulty level usually is about a 60-40 proposition that I would succeed against the AI. It's all about the start. You have to have a good sized land mass with plenty of native/barbarian villages. Start off by switching to all material production until you have 3 warriors. Then redistribute your workers to focus mainly on science and food but have enough production to train an archer as soon as you have the appropriate tech. Those Warriors you trained should be sent out immediately after they are trained to start taking out barbarian villages so you get the gold to get the settler money bonus. If you get stuck on an island then you are fucked and might as well just start a new game.
